VS Code 源码编辑器下载及环境配置教程

在开始使用 VS Code 进行代码编辑之前,确保正确下载并配置编辑器环境至关重要。本文将基于当前网络热搜信息,提供 VS Code 源码编辑器的官方下载途径及基础环境配置步骤,帮助开发者快速启动开发工作。

VS Code 官方下载链接获取

最新版本的 VS Code 可通过官方网站获取,以下是权威渠道提供的下载链接:

平台 下载链接
Windows https://code.visualstudio.com/sha/download?build=stable&os=win32-x64
macOS https://code.visualstudio.com/sha/download?build=stable&os=darwin-x64
Linux https://code.visualstudio.com/sha/download?build=stable&os=linux-x64

注意:请始终通过官方链接下载,避免使用第三方来源可能存在的捆绑软件或版本问题。

Windows 系统环境变量配置

为在 Windows 系统中全局使用 VS Code 命令行工具,需将安装路径添加至系统环境变量 PATH 中:

set PATH=%USERPROFILE%AppDataLocalProgramsMicrosoft VS Codebin;%PATH%

执行以上命令后,需重启命令提示符或 PowerShell 才能生效。可通过以下命令验证配置是否成功:

code --version

若返回版本信息,则配置成功。

macOS 系统权限设置

在 macOS 系统中,为允许 VS Code 通过终端访问文件系统,需执行以下命令:

xattr -d com.apple.FSQuarantine ~/Applications/Visual Studio Code.app

此命令可移除系统对 VS Code 的隔离状态,确保所有功能正常运行。

Linux 系统依赖安装

在 Linux 系统中安装 VS Code 前需确保已安装以下依赖:

sudo apt update
sudo apt install -y wget gpg

获取安装脚本后,执行:

wget -qO- https://code.visualstudio.com/sha/download?build=stable&os=linux-deb-x64 | sudo apt install -

完成后,可通过以下命令启动:

code .

或直接在终端中使用 code 命令。

插件安装与配置

以下为 VS Code 开发中常用必备插件列表及安装方法:

插件名称 用途 安装命令
Python Python 语言支持 Install Microsoft Python
GitLens Git 功能增强 Install GitLens by SourceTree
CSS Peek CSS 代码预览 Install CSS Peek
REST Client API 测试 Install REST Client

安装后,可在扩展市场中搜索并安装这些插件,或使用以下命令批量安装:

code --install-extension ms-python.python
code --install-extension gitlens.gitlens
code --install-extension dbaeumer.vscode-eslint
code --install-extension humao.rest-client

开发环境基础设置

为提升开发效率,建议进行以下基础配置:

{
  "files.associations": {
    ".sh": "shellscript",
    ".md": "markdown"
  },
  "editor.codeActionsOnSave": {
    "source.fixAll": true
  },
  "search.exclude": {
    "/.git": true,
    "/.svn": true,
    "/.hg": true,
    "/CVS": true,
    "/.DS_Store": true
  },
  "workbench.editor.enablePreview": false,
  "python.analysis.memory.keepLibraryAst": false,
  "python.analysis.indexing": true
}

以上配置通过 VS Code 的设置界面(File → Preferences → Settings)粘贴即可应用,主要优化了文件关联、保存时自动修复、搜索排除项及 Python 代码分析设置。

多环境管理技巧

对于需要管理多个开发环境的情况,可使用以下方法:

code --user-data-dir ~/.vscode-dev --new-window

此命令将在新的用户数据目录下启动 VS Code,可用于隔离不同项目的配置。同时可在设置中配置多个工作区(Workspaces)。

远程开发环境配置

若需配置远程开发环境,可使用以下步骤:

  1. 安装 Remote-SSH 扩展
  2. 在 VS Code 中添加远程服务器(Terminal → Remote Explorer → Add New Remote)
  3. 使用 ssh 连接到远程服务器
  4. 通过 Remote-SSH 扩展提供的界面管理远程文件

此方法无需在本地安装完整开发环境,可直接使用远程服务器的工具链。

问题排查常见解决方案

在安装和使用过程中可能遇到以下常见问题:

  1. 插件安装失败:检查网络连接,确保使用最新版 VS Code
  2. 代码高亮异常:更新或重新安装语言服务扩展
  3. 启动缓慢:禁用非必要的插件,清理设置中的冗余配置
  4. 终端无响应:检查 Remote-DevTools 扩展配置

若问题持续存在,建议通过 VS Code 的问题报告功能(Help → Report Issues)提交详细信息。

以上文章内容为AI辅助生成,仅供参考,需辨别文章内容信息真实有效

声明:本站所有文章,如无特殊说明或标注,均为本站原创发布。任何个人或组织,在未征得本站同意时,禁止复制、盗用、采集、发布本站内容到任何网站、书籍等各类媒体平台。如若本站内容侵犯了原著者的合法权益,可联系我们进行处理。